Elitebook 840 g3
Microsoft Windows 10 (64-bit)

I'd like to purchase and install a M.2 ssd card in this notebook.

 

Rather confusing. Will different sizes fit (IE: 60mm or 80mm)?

 

And will the Samsung SSD 850 EVO M.2 1TB & 500GB work?

Hi,

 

They (840 G3 laptops) have the following options:

 

SSDs:

● M.2 (2280) 512 GB SATA-3 TLC

● M.2 (2280) 256 GB PCIe-3×4 SS NVMe

● M.2 (2280) 256 GB SATA-3 self-encrypting (Opal 2) MLC

● M.2 (2280) 256 GB SATA-3 TLC

● M.2 (2280) 240 GB SATA-3 MLC DS

● M.2 (2280) 180 GB SATA-3 self-encrypting (Opal 2) MLC

● M.2 (2280) 180 GB SATA-3 MLC

● M.2 (2280) 128 GB SATA-3 TLC

 

In short, 80mm. Samsung SSD should work but please use Device Manager to check its current brand and buy the SAME brand to make sure compatible.

I see one of those M.2 drives says PCIe-3x4, but all of the rest say SATA-3. Will it use PCIe based M.2 drives?

HP Recommended

I have the Elitebook 745 G3 and the relevant parts of the product PDF have this same list of M.2 SSDs, I believe.

 

I posted a question in this forum about installing a 512 GB PCIe SSD (max on the list is 256 GB) but I received no reply.

 

Well, I went ahead and got the SSD and installed it. It works! 

 

Your experience may differ, however.  I guess the only way to find out is to do it yourself!
